π Preparation Steps
1
Make the dressing first to allow the flavors time to blend. Add the oil, rice vinegar, soy sauce, toasted sesame oil, brown sugar, fresh grated ginger, and sesame seeds to a small jar or bowl. Whisk the ingredients together or close the jar and shake to combine. Set the dressing aside until ready to use.

2
Spread the broccoli florets out on a baking sheet. Begin to preheat the oven to 400ΒΊF. Place the baking sheet with broccoli on the stove top as the oven preheats to allow them to begin to thaw. Once the broccoli is soft enough to slice, cut any large florets into smaller bite-sized pieces. Drizzle the broccoli with 1 Tbsp oil and and pinch of salt, and toss to coat.

3
Roast the broccoli for β±οΈ 30 minutes in the preheated oven, stirring after β±οΈ 20 minutes. Sprinkle the sliced almonds over the broccoli after β±οΈ 25 minutes, and allow them to roast together for the final five minutes. Take the broccoli and almonds out of the oven and allow them to cool (β±οΈ 5-10 minutes).
4
Once the broccoli is mostly cooled, add the crunchy lo mein noodles and sliced green onions, and stir to combine. Give the simple sesame dressing another stir or shake, and then drizzle the dressing over the baking sheet. Stir until everything is coated in dressing. Serve immediately.
